Work has recently commenced on Green Power Energy Limited’s geothermal project at Esperance, with Southern Geoscience Consultants (SGC) appointed to source and analyse all existing geotechnical information in the area. Together with Greenpower’s in-house work, this is expected to enable the company to outline the extent of the heat producing granites in the project area.
In this initial phase of work, emphasis will be on evaluation of the magnetic data for assessing the extent of the granites, and using the gravity data to assist with geometry definition of the main granite bodies in the area.
Preliminary qualitative analysis suggests that there is at least one granite body with an area in excess of 600 km square and which has strong thermal potential.
Greenpower Energy is an Australian public listed explorer and developer of greenhouse friendly energy sourced from fossil fuels. It has approximately two million hectares of commercially-attractive tenements in three Australian states.
